re-a'-ya, re-i'-a (re'ayah, "Yah has seen"; Septuagint: Codex Vaticanus, Rhada, A, Rheia):
(1) The eponym of a Calebite family (1Ch 4:2). The word "Reaiah" should probably be substituted for "Haroeh" in1Ch 2:52, but both forms may be corruptions.
(2) A Reubenite (1Ch 5:5, the King James Version "Reaia").
SeeJOEL.
(3) The family name of a company of Nethinim (Ezr 2:47;Ne 7:50= /RAPC 1Es 5:31).
